The Karnataka Ratna is the highest civilian honour of the State of Karnataka, India. It is awarded in recognition of a person's extraordinary contribution in any field. It was instituted in the year 1992 by the then Chief Minister of Karnataka, S. Bangarappa by the Government of Karnataka. A total of twelve persons have received this award.
